%N Numbers n from A181780 that are not in A181781.
%C Numbers that are Fermat pseudoprimes to some base a (2<=a<=n-2) not Euler pseudoprimes to any base a (2<=a<=n-2).
%e 4^(15-1) == 1 (mod 15), but 4^((15-1)/2) == 4 (mod 15)
